Output 91c66c46fa804a3eeb41d78716cf4628df52790bd7bcaa2c8da2c1a5ec94ce4e:0

value
3376580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f580e44b98bc6c52baff7347bf4071da612a1cd7 OP_EQUALVERIFY OP_CHECKSIG
address
1PP6xZG9F7vPpGby16sqLPNnhDT7tNEgWY
transaction
91c66c46fa804a3eeb41d78716cf4628df52790bd7bcaa2c8da2c1a5ec94ce4e
confirmations
449226
spent
true